Ripple taps Absa to bring bank-grade crypto custody to South Africa
Ripple has partnered with South Africa’s Absa Bank to provide digital asset custody services, expanding its institutional custody network across Africa.

Bitcoin Meets IP: Lombard and Story Launch Partnership for Creator Economy
Lombard, a Bitcoin-based decentralized finance (DeFi) platform, and Story, a layer one (L1) blockchain designed to make intellectual property (IP) programmable, have announced a strategic partnership aimed at linking Bitcoin-backed finance with digital content monetization.
